Transaction 0939e3dd2148106a4cdc60053ae0c2b8d80680676fc919714c142dd7125835a9
1 Input
1 Output
-
0939e3dd2148106a4cdc60053ae0c2b8d80680676fc919714c142dd7125835a9:0
- value
- 502900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80f37948ced7c3b794d34c807731e64571f13264 OP_EQUAL
- address
- 3DSr5xAfbmQbNeKFCyWy94ikd3NzxKuk3X